Bank Interest meaning
Bank interest is a term that refers to the amount of money that a bank pays to its customers for keeping their money in a savings account or a fixed deposit account. The interest rate is usually expressed as a percentage of the amount deposited and is calculated on an annual basis. 1. Use it in a sentence to explain the concept of bank interest Bank interest is the amount of money that a bank pays to its customers for keeping their money in a savings account or a fixed deposit account.
2. Use it in a sentence to compare different bank interest rates The bank interest rates offered by different banks vary, so it is important to compare them before choosing a bank to deposit your money.
3. Use it in a sentence to explain the benefits of earning bank interest Earning bank interest is a great way to grow your savings over time, as the interest earned is added to your account balance and earns interest itself.
4. Use it in a sentence to explain the risks associated with bank interest While earning bank interest is generally considered safe, there is always a risk that the bank may fail or that inflation may erode the value of your savings over time.
5. Use it in a sentence to explain the difference between simple and compound interest Simple interest is calculated on the principal amount only, while compound interest is calculated on the principal amount plus any interest earned.
6. Use it in a sentence to explain the impact of interest rates on the economy Interest rates have a significant impact on the economy, as they affect the cost of borrowing and the return on savings, which in turn affects consumer spending and investment.
7. Use it in a sentence to explain the role of the central bank in setting interest rates The central bank is responsible for setting interest rates, which it does in order to achieve its monetary policy objectives, such as controlling inflation or promoting economic growth.
8. Use it in a sentence to explain the difference between nominal and real interest rates Nominal interest rates are the rates that are actually paid or earned, while real interest rates take into account the effects of inflation on the purchasing power of the money.
9. Use it in a sentence to explain the impact of interest rates on the stock market Changes in interest rates can have a significant impact on the stock market, as they affect the cost of borrowing and the return on investment, which in turn affects the valuation of stocks.
